Sass @if 指令17 Mar 2025 | 阅读 2 分钟 @if 指令指定根据表达式的结果执行代码语句。 @if 语句可以与多个 @if else 语句和一个 @else 语句一起使用。 @if 指令有两种类型
@if 指令Sass @if 指令接受 SassScript 表达式,如果表达式返回除 false 或 null 以外的任何内容,则使用嵌套样式。 例如:如果您使用以下 SCSS 文件。 SCSS 语法 编译后,它将创建一个包含以下代码的 CSS 文件 CSS 语法 Sass @if 指令示例让我们举一个例子来演示 Sass @if 指令的用法。 我们有一个名为“simple.html”的 HTML 文件,其中包含以下数据。 HTML 文件:simple.html 创建一个名为“simple.scss”的 SCSS 文件,其中包含以下数据。 SCSS 文件:simple.scss 将这两个文件放在根文件夹中。 现在,打开命令提示符并运行 watch 命令,告诉 SASS 监视文件并在 SASS 文件更改时更新 CSS。 执行以下代码:sass --watch simple.scss:simple.css 它将自动在同一目录中创建一个名为“simple.css”的普通 CSS 文件。 例如 ![]() 创建的 CSS 文件“simple.css”包含以下代码 现在,执行上面的 html 文件,它将读取 CSS 值。 输出: 下一个主题@else-if 指令 |
我们请求您订阅我们的新闻通讯以获取最新更新。